How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Falcon Estates?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Falcon Estates Studio Apartments | $1,313 | $1,027 | $1,594 |
| Falcon Estates 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,513 | $1,005 | $5,025 |
| Falcon Estates 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,807 | $799 | $5,730 |
| Falcon Estates 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,240 | $525 | $6,482 |
| Falcon Estates 4 Bedroom Apartments | $499 | $499 | $499 |
